Renascor Resources raising funds for Australia's largest graphite deposit

The halt will remain in place until Thursday 21st September 2017.

Renascor Resources Ltd (ASX:RNU) is developing Australia's largest graphite deposit, with the Tier-1 asset known as the Siviour project.

Siviour has favourable flake size distribution and high purities for lithium-ion batteries, and other high growth markets.

Siviour is also among the largest reported graphite deposits in the world, within a shallow, flat-lying mineralised body.

Renascor is now heading to market with a capital raising, and the ASX has granted a trading halt to prepare.

The halt will remain in place until the opening of trade on Thursday 21st September 2017, or earlier if an announcement is made to the market.
